Page 1 sur 1

[S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 13:52
par Silejonu
Bonjour,

Nouvel arrivant sur Linux, et sur ArchLinux plus particulièrement, je me suis attelé à la configuration de mon système, et en ce moment de SLiM et OpenBox.
Mon problème est que SLiM refuse de se connecter à mon utilisateur "silejonu", mais par contre, aucun problème pour le root.

Merci d'avance pour l'aide. :chinois:

PS : :google: ne m'a pas été d'une grande aide...

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 14:26
par benjarobin
Comment tu lance ton environnement graphique et comment as tu créé ton utilisateur ? L'utilisateur appartient à quels groupes ? Arrives tu as te connecter avec ton utilisateur dans un tty ?

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 14:37
par oktoberfest
En complément à benjarobin : as-tu créé un $HOME/.xinitrc ? Est-ce que si tu te loggues en console, tu peux lancer X via startx ?

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 15:10
par Silejonu
Alors, je lance mon environnement graphique avec "openbox-session" dans le ~/.xinitrc.
J'ai créé mon utilisateur en tty, avec :

Code : Tout sélectionner

adduser -G audio,lp,optical,power,scanner,storage,users,video silejonu
Aucun problème pour me connecter dans un tty, et même dans un émulateur de terminal.
Je peux lancer X via startx.
Je fais un test en entrant "exec openbox-sessions" dans /home/silejonu/.xinitrc.

EDIT : Verdict : ça me connecte, maintenant, mais ça me met un message d'erreur à propos de Nautilus, que je n'ai pas installé... Mais OpenBox se lance quand même.

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 15:16
par Ypnose
Je croix qu'il y a un "s" en trop.

Code : Tout sélectionner

exec openbox-session

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 15:30
par Silejonu
Ypnose a écrit :Je croix qu'il y a un "s" en trop.

Code : Tout sélectionner

exec openbox-session
Non, je me suis simplement trompé en recopiant, tout va bien dans mon xinitrc.

Re: [SLiM] Slim failed to execute login command

Publié : ven. 05 août 2011, 15:36
par Silejonu
oktoberfest a écrit :En complément à benjarobin : as-tu créé un $HOME/.xinitrc ? Est-ce que si tu te loggues en console, tu peux lancer X via startx ?
En fait, la méthode du xinitrc a fonctionné, je me suis intéressé un peu plus au message de Nautilus, et c'est rien du tout, juste un problème de permissions, il me semble. :oops:
Du coup, problème réglé, merci beaucoup, et désolé du dérangement. :bravo:
Je vais tout réinstaller, moi, histoire d'avoir un système tout propre.

Re: [S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 15:42
par oktoberfest
Silejonu a écrit :Je vais tout réinstaller, moi, histoire d'avoir un système tout propre.
Une pensée émue pour FoolEcho... :cdmalad:

Re: [S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 15:52
par FoolEcho
@oktoberfest: :fou:
Silejonu a écrit :En fait, la méthode du xinitrc a fonctionné, je me suis intéressé un peu plus au message de Nautilus, et c'est rien du tout, juste un problème de permissions, il me semble. :oops:
Toi, tu lances des applications graphiques en root à tous les coups, et maintenant ça te pourri ton home: facile à rectifier, cf. sujets sur le forum (mots clés: "chown" "user" ... :roll: )
Silejonu a écrit :Je vais tout réinstaller, moi, histoire d'avoir un système tout propre.
Et donc, ton système est propre, pitié, inutile de réinstaller... :pleure:

Re: [S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 17:34
par Silejonu
Oui, effectivement, j'ai tout lancé en root. Parce que ça marchait pas en utilisateur simple, enfin, si, mais je pouvais pas ouvrir ma session en utilisateur simple.
Je préfère tout réinstaller histoire de bien m'imprégner de toutes les étapes, et de repartir sur des bases claires. Parce qu'à côté, j'ai fait n'importe quoi. De toute façon, je comptais faire une première installation n'importe comment histoire de découvrir un peu, puis tout réinstaller ensuite. Et puis, c'est pas comme si une installation de plus ou de moins me changeait grand-chose. ^^

Re: [S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 17:58
par FoolEcho
*soupir* ... :haine: ... car (en admettant que tu aies conservé ton home à la réinstallation, ce qui est probable) tu serais retombé sur le même problème de droits (ou tu l'aurais refaite, et vu les conséquences plus tard...)... ... et pour les essais d'installation, il y a les machines virtuelles...

M'enfin bon... ce sont vos machines, faites comme vous voulez... :mrgreen:
Silejonu a écrit :Oui, effectivement, j'ai tout lancé en root. Parce que ça marchait pas en utilisateur simple
Ce n'est jamais une bonne solution dans la mesure où trop d'utilisateurs n'utilisent pas su et/ou sudo correctement... avant même de se poser et de se demander pourquoi ça ne fonctionne pas en utilisateur... :chinois:

Re: [SLiM] Slim failed to execute login command (Résolu)

Publié : ven. 05 août 2011, 18:17
par Silejonu
Comme je l'ai dit, c'était une installation de test, je n'avais pas envie de "m'encombrer" de sudo. Je voulais comprendre sans être "bridé". Enfin, j'avais surtout la flemme de taper sudo pour une installation temporaire. ^^
Je n'ai aucune raison de conserver mon /home, vu que je n'ai rien dessus. Et c'est une machine toute neuve, sans OS, donc pas de virtualisation.